GMB star reveals horror after being robbed and spat on
A GOOD Morning Britain presenter has told of being racially abused and spat on during a horror mugging by a teenager.
The juvenile, later arrested after being chased by the star of the breakfast show, appeared before magistrates where the judge spared him jail.: “I was completely shocked. I didn't realise what was happening.Noel's attacker, who dropped the necklace in a 90 second pursuit, later tripped and fell, allowing the presenter and police to restrain him.
